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court held that the High Court's cancellation of anticipatory bail under Section 438 of the Code of Criminal Procedure was unjustified, as the original FIR did not include allegations of rape, and the charge under Section 376 IPC was added only in 2014, long after the initial complaint. The Court emphasized that the delay in framing charges and the nature of allegations must be considered when assessing the necessity of anticipatory bail. Consequently, the Court reinstated the anticipatory bail granted to the appellant by the Sessions Court.
